5.0 CANBus Module Placement/System Wiring
Your CANBus system modules are all interconnected by means of Two Wires
- CANH (CAN High) and CANL (CAN Low) - plus the addition of a common shield wire. It is
Important to the operation of your CANBus system that the recommended module placement
and system wiring be followed very closely. Improperly placed/wired CANBus modules may
result in an inoperable system. It is important to carefully map out how you will route the
CANH and CANL signals from module to module so as not to compromise the signal
integrity because this information makes its way from one point to another on
your application.
Different Types of Modules
As received, the CANBus modules you have been supplied with
have been configured to be wired in a specific order based on your
application.
There are two types of modules your system could possibly use.
Full Termination : This is a CANBus module that has been
placed at the start or at the end of a BUS line
Stub Termination : This is a CANBus module that has been
placed in between the modules with full termination.
